Beef Jerky and Quinoa Salad
A protein-packed salad combining unsalted beef jerky with quinoa, fresh vegetables, and a zesty lemon dressing for a nutritious meal.
- 1 cup cooked quinoa
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cucumber, diced
- 1/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
- In a large bowl, combine cooked quinoa, chopped beef jerky,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and red onion.
- In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the salad, toss well, and serve chilled.
Beef Jerky-Stuffed Avocados
Creamy avocados filled with a savory mixture of unsalted beef jerky, Greek yogurt, and spices, perfect for a healthy snack or light meal.
- 2 ripe avocados
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
- 1 tsp lime juice
- 1/2 tsp cumin
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Cut the avocados in half and remove the pit.
- In a bowl, mix chopped beef jerky, Greek yogurt, lime juice, cumin, salt, and pepper.
- Spoon the mixture into the avocado halves and serve immediately.
Beef Jerky and Sweet Potato Hash
A hearty breakfast hash featuring sweet potatoes, unsalted beef jerky, and bell peppers, providing a nutritious start to your day.
- 2 medium sweet potatoes, diced
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1 small onion, diced
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ley for garnish
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at, add sweet potatoes, and cook until tender.
- Add chopped beef jerky, bell pepper, and onion, cooking until the vegetables are soft.
- Season with salt and pepper, garnish with parsley, and serve warm.
Beef Jerky Trail Mix
A nutritious and energizing trail mix made with unsalted beef jerky, nuts, seeds, and dried fruit, perfect for on-the-go snacking.
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1 cup mixed nuts (almonds, walnuts, cashews)
- 1/2 cup pumpkin seeds
- 1/2 cup dried cranberries
- 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
- In a large bowl, combine chopped beef jerky, mixed nuts, pumpkin seeds, dried cranberries, and dark chocolate chips.
- Toss everything together until well mixed.
- Store in an airtight container for a healthy snack anytime.
Beef Jerky and Spinach Omelette
A protein-rich omelette featuring unsalted beef jerky and fresh spinach, perfect for a nutritious breakfast or brunch.
- 3 large eggs
- 2 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1 cup fresh spinach
- 1/4 cup shredded cheese (optional)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- In a bowl, whisk the eggs with salt and pepper.
- Heat olive oil in a non-stick skillet, add spinach, and sauté until wilted.
- Pour in the eggs, sprinkle with beef jerky and cheese, cook until set, then fold and serve.
Beef Jerky Lettuce Wraps
Fresh lettuce leaves filled with a savory mixture of unsalted beef jerky, veggies, and a light sauce, making for a low-carb meal.
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1 cup shredded carrots
- 1/2 cup cucumber, diced
- 1/4 cup green onions, sliced
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
- Butter lettuce leaves for wrapping
- In a bowl, mix chopped beef jerky, shredded carrots, cucumber, green onions, soy sauce, and sesame oil.
- Spoon the mixture onto butter lettuce leaves.
- Wrap and enjoy as a healthy, low-carb meal.
Beef Jerky and Hummus Platter
A delightful platter featuring unsalted beef jerky paired with homemade hummus and fresh vegetables for dipping.
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ky
- 1 cup chickpeas, cooked
- 2 tbsp tahini
- 1 garlic clove
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- Juice of 1 lemon
- Salt to taste
- Assorted veggies for dipping
- In a food processor, blend chickpeas, tahini, garlic, olive oil, lemon juice, and salt until smooth.
- Serve the hummus with beef jerky and assorted fresh vegetables for dipping.
- Enjoy as a healthy appetizer or snack.
Beef Jerky and Cauliflower Rice Stir-Fry
A quick and healthy stir-fry featuring unsalted beef jerky and cauliflower rice, loaded with colorful vegetables.
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, sliced
- 2 cups cauliflower rice
- 1 cup mixed bell peppers, sliced
- 1/2 cup snap peas
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p ginger, grated
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et, add ginger, and sauté for a minute.
- Add bell peppers and snap peas, cooking until tender.
- Stir in cauliflower rice and beef jerky, add soy sauce, and cook until heated through.
Beef Jerky and Chickpea Salad
A hearty salad combining unsalted beef jerky with chickpeas, fresh herbs, and a tangy vinaigrette for a satisfying meal.
- 1 can chickpeas, rinsed and drained
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, chopped
- 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1/4 cup parsley, chopped
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p red wine vinegar
- Salt and pepper to taste
- In a large bowl, combine chickpeas, chopped beef jerky, cherry tomatoes, and parsley.
- In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, red wine vinegar,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the salad, toss well, and serve.
Beef Jerky and Zucchini Noodles
A light and healthy dish featuring zucchini noodles tossed with unsalted beef jerky and a savory garlic sauce.
- 2 medium zucchinis, spiralized
- 4 oz unsalted beef jerky, sliced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es
- Salt and pepper to taste
- In a skillet, heat olive oil and sauté garlic until fragrant.
- Add beef jerky and zucchini noodles, tossing to combine.
- Season with red pepper flakes, salt, and pepper, cooking until zucchini is tender.
